Surge in new car sales boosts Exchequer coffers

Over 10,000 more new cars have been sold in the first six months of this year than in the entire of 2009, new figures indicated today.

Date from the Society of the Irish Motor Industry (SIMI) showed 67,846 new car sales from January to June, generating €60m more for the Exchequer than for the same period last year
